Liberal Democrat Win in Wadebridge East (Cornwall)

7 Sep 2013

There were a number of by-elections on Thursday. Congratulations to Stephen Knightley who won in Cornwall for the Lib Dems.

Stephen Knightley (Lib Dem) was elected as the new Cornwall Councillor for Wadebridge East with 408 votes. It was a close fought race with Independent Tony Rush gaining just nine votes less. The by-election was called after Independent Colin Brewer stood down. The turnout was a healthy 40.47%.

Full result: Stephen Knightley (Lib Dem) 408; Tony Rush (Ind) 399; Stephen Rushworth (Con) 217; Roderick Harrison (UKIP) 202; Adrian Jones (Labour) 58.
